Currently leading the premier institution of Jammu, MIET, he is known for his unparalleled leadership qualities. Maj. Gen. Sharma gave an impressive presentation highlighting the meaning of leadership, its various theories and styles like charismatic leadership theory, traits theory, behavioural theory and situational theory. He asked the participants to assess their own leadership style by filling a questionnaire. According to him, the essential ingredients of academic leadership are vision, communication, motivation, problem solving, counseling, value ethics and decision making. The session was quite interactive and the queries of the participants were answered suitably. Dr. Renu Gupta also addressed the participants and said that leadership is simply knowing what to do and getting things done. She said that a teacher is also a leader and the leadership qualities of a teacher determine the success of the students. We all have a leader hidden in all of us and it has to be brought out with training and capacity building. A teacher needs to tune his leadership skills and find the best style of teaching.
